FF: MQ and the GB FF's (FFL's) are not technically "official" FF games, they were simply renamed as such in North America to convince FF lovers to buy them. The GB games were actually the first game in the SaGa series, which has now gone through several iterations on various systems (Romancing, Frontier, Unlimited).

Also, the GB title FFA was actually the original Seiken Densetsu, the second game of which series is known as Secret of Mana in North America. This game, of course, was recently re-made as Sword of Mana for GBA.
